imigogo

Word parts: imi-gogo

ee-mee-GOH-goh

How to say it

Kirundiimigogoee-mee-GOH-gohsoon
Englishlogs, footbridgessoon
Frenchtroncs, petits pontssoon

Meaning

Logs, or simple footbridges made from a log laid across a stream.

Good to know

plural of umugogo (umu-/imi- class).

Examples

  • Imigogo yashizwe hejuru y'umugende kugira twambuke.Logs were placed over the stream so we could cross.
  • Ese imigogo yose ikomeye?Are all the logs sturdy?
  • Imigogo ntibura kuboneka mu mashamba yacu.Logs are never lacking in our forests.
  • Abakozi bazokwubaka imigogo mishasha y'itambuko.The workers will build new log footbridges.
